I wont' got into all of the boring details, but suffice it to say that I have WDW Dining on speed dial. I made my original ADRs at 180 days and have changed them a few times since. So as of today here are my plans. I make no promises that they won't change again though.

Saturday, May 3
9:30 - Manicure/Pedicure appointment (the fingers and toes have to look nice )
12:30 - Head to the airport
6:30 - Land in Orlando
DME to Pop
I plan to either have dinner at the Pop food court or if I'm feeling like it head to DTD and eat at EoS.

Sunday, May 4
Breakfast at Pop food court
Check out of Pop and have luggage transferred to BCV
Go to BCV and check in. The room probably won't be ready so I plan to head to Epcot for awhile and enjoy the F&GF. I am so excited that I can walk over there!
Lunch will either be WS CS or Rose & Crown Pub
I'll head back to BCV early afternoon to spend some time at SAB and hopefully get into my room and settle in. I got a letter not long ago that they're closing the slide at SAB on Monday so I want to be sure to get there on Sunday. This 52 year old still loves the slides!
I have a 6:10 ADR at California Grill and then plan to spend the evening at MK EEMH. (It's open until 1:00 am! )

Monday, May 5
Sleep in (I know - it's for suckers )
Head to DTD for some shopping and have lunch at either EoS or WPC depending on my mood and the lines.
More time at SAB this afternoon.
Dinner at FFC and then DHS EEMH.

Tuesday, May 6
Up EARLY! (not a sucker today )
Meet Sharon (Grandmasam) in the lobby at 6:45 to take a cab to WL. We're walking from there over to Trails End for breakfast before our Ft Wilderness Segway Tour! I am so excited about this tour. I've done Around the World on a Segway at Epcot twice and it. I'm also looking forward to meeting another Passporter!
After the tour I'll head to MK for awhile. Lunch will be CS. Depending on how I'm feeling I'll either head back for more SAB time or a nap before dinner.
Dinner is at Bistro de Paris.

Wednesday, May 7
Alice arrives today. We plan to spend the day at the F&GF at Epcot.
Lunch is at Chefs de France.
SAB is a possibility.
Dinner is at Spoodles.
Evening will depend on how tired we are. We might try Jellyrolls since we'll be near there.

Thursday, May 8
Check out of BCV
Alice and I are taking the Gardens of the World Tour. With her love of gardening I thought she might really enjoy a tour lead by a WDW horticulturist. I have never taken a tour at WDW that I didn't enjoy. They always point out details that I've somehow over looked. This should be fun!
Terri arrives around lunch time.
Check into BWV
Lunch at Beaches and Cream
Afternoon will be up to Alice. Either back to Epcot or pool time.
Eventually I'll head over to AK and Alice will head home.
Dinner - Y&Y and then EEMH

Friday, May 9
Morning at MK - I think that's what we planned. Am I right Terri?
Lunch - CS
Head to Epcot sometime in the afternoon
Dinner - Tepan Edo
EEMH at Epcot

Saturday, May 10
Up early
Breakfast at Spoodles
Check out of BWV and head to MEMH at DHS
This will be a quick trip to experience the AP preview of Toy Story Mania! When they announced this Terri and I moved our breakfast ADR early to try to fit this in. We'll be dashing when it's over to head to Port Canavaral for the Westbound PC cruise!

There will be many firsts for me on this trip. Several of my ADRs are new for me: California Grill, Trail's End, Bistro de Paris, Yak and Yeti, Tepan Edo, and Spoodles for Breakfast. I've never eaten in the Rose & Crown Pub (only the dining room) or at Beaches and Cream or the Pop food court. This will also be my first time staying at Pop, BCV and BWV (or any Epcot resort for that matter). Both tours are new as well. I will also be seeing the F&GF for the first time.

Besides my meet with Grandmasam I hope to meet up with Jookiba some time. Either at the Beach Club or maybe at AK. There are several other PPers who will be there, but our schedules aren't overlapping. Hopefully we'll run into each other at some time. I also hear a rumor that there may be a surprise appearance in this TR by an exteemed member of the PPer family. I've been sworn to secrecy, but stay tuned.
